Band 6+: Because many children are not able to learn foreign languages, schools should not force them to learn. To what extent do you agree or disagree?

Note: Both the topic and the essay were created by one of our users.

The debate about that schools should mandate foreign language learning for children is a important one, with many believing that is essential for their development .I strongly agree that schools should require foreign education.

One significant reason is the cognitive benefits it provides. Knowledge of two or more languages enhances problem-solving skills and improves memory. Besides, it encourages children to think in a different ways, which can help them do better in other subjects as well. Eventually, this mental exercises is useful when kids are young and their brains are open to learning new things. In addition, knowing another language can be a big plus when looking for jobs in the future, as many employers appreciate candidates who can communicate in more than one language.

In addition, another important reason of learning foreign language is the promotion of cultural awareness between students. Language is closely tied to culture and by learning new language children can learn about the traditions and values of other nationality. This really useful for students worldview. Learning foreign languages will reduce misunderstandings, promote kindness and respect for others. , Subsequently, this will help children in travel and enhance their ability to connect with people from different cultures. When kids can communicate in another language, they are more likely to engage with locals, understand cultural nuances, and build meaningful relationships during their travels.

In conclusion, I believe that schools should require children to learn foreign languages. The benefits, such as improved thinking skills and better job opportunities, are significant. Moreover, learning a new language helps students understand different cultures
